will this unit be compatable with my columbus RNS510   BLUETOOTH PHONE INTERFACE BOX CONTROL UNIT ECU 1K8 035 730 D

as the bluetooth module i have 3c8 035 730 B DOSENT LIKE THE NEW APPLE IOS 11 UPDATE

 
 

s-l500 (1) blutooth.jpg

Edited by craigandrew

the 1k8 module is very basic

 

if you have a 3c8035730b you should replace it with a newer 3c8035730e

A quick google suggest people are having iOS11 issues across various car brands so it might be worth waiting for apple to release a fix.

 

I know it's not an immediate solution, but unless you know a different BT module will fix it, I wouldn't spend the cash yet...
